45badf864f freertos(IDF): Allow cross-core freeing of task memory when deleting tasks
Previously, IDF FreeRTOS would restrict the clean up of task memory (done by
vTaskDelete() or the Idle task) to only tasks pinned to the current core or
unpinned tasks. This was due to the need to clear the task's coprocessor
ownership on the other core (i.e., "_xt_coproc_owner_sa"). But this restriction
can be lifted by simply protecting access of "_xt_coproc_owner_sa" with a
spinlock.

This commit implements a "_xt_coproc_owner_sa_lock" to protect the access of
"_xt_coproc_owner_sa", thus vTaskDelete() and prvDeleteTCB() can now delete
tasks pinned to the other core so long as that task is not currently running.

Note: This fix was copied from the Xtensa port of Amazon SMP FreeRTOS

c318c89453 freertos(IDF): Remove dependency on portUSING_MPU_WRAPPERS
This commit removes the dependency on portUSING_MPU_WRAPPERS on the Xtensa port
of IDF FreeRTOS. This dependency was added due to a hack implemented in the
upstream port that required the usage of the "xMPUSettings" member of the TCB.
The "xMPUSettings" would be used as a pointer to the task's coprocessor save
area on the stack, even though FreeRTOS MPU support was not available.

The hack has now been removed, and the CPSA pointer is now calculated using
a combination of constant offsets values and the pxEndOfStack member of the
TCB.

Note: This impelemtation was copied from the Xtensa port of Amazon SMP FreeRTOS.

9300bef9b8 freertos(SMP): Refactor FPU handling on the Xtensa port of Amaazon SMP FreeRTOS
This commit refactors the FPU handling code on the Xtensa port of Amazon SMP
FreeRTOS in the following ways:

Auto-pinning via XT_RTOS_CP_EXC_HOOK
------------------------------------

The "_xt_coproc_exc" exception would previously automatically pin a task that
uses the FPU to the current core (to ensure that we can lazy save the task's FPU
context). However, this would mean that "xtensa_vectors.S" would need to be
OS-aware (to read the task's TCB structure).

This is now refactored so that "_xt_coproc_exc" calls a CP exception hook
function ("XT_RTOS_CP_EXC_HOOK") implemented in "portasm.S", thus allowing
"xtensa_vectors.S" to remain OS agnostic.

Using macros to acquire owner spinlock
--------------------------------------

The taking and relasing of the "_xt_coproc_owner_sa_lock" is now mostly
abstracted as the "spinlock_take" and "spinlock_release" macro. As a result,
"_xt_coproc_release" and "_xt_coproc_exc" are refactored so that:

- They are closer to their upstream (original) versions
- The spinlock is only taken when building for multicore
- The spinlock held region is shortened (now only protects the instructions
  that access the "_xt_coproc_owner_sa" array

Other Changes
-------------

- Updated placing and comments of various "offset_..." constants used by
  portasm.S
- Update description of "get_cpsa_from_tcb" assembly macro
- Tidied up some typos in the ".S" files

fd48daf278 freertos(SMP): Fix SMP FreeRTOS Xtensa port FPU/Coproccessor bugs
This commit fixes the following FPU/Coprocessor bugs in the Xtensa port of
Amazon SMP FreeRTOS:

- vPortCleanUpCoprocArea() does not calculate the correct pointer to the
task's CPSA (located on the task's stack). This can result in
    - _xt_coproc_release() not releasing the task's CP ownership
    - The next coprocessor exception will write the current CP owner (i.e., the
      deleted task's CPSA) leading to memory corruption
- _xt_coproc_release() writes xCoreID instead of 0 when clearing a CP owner.
  This results in the next CP exception trying to load the CP owner's CPSA at
  the address of "xCoreID", leading to a double exception.

8b98e4e3b8 freertos(IDF): Restore vanilla call behavior on xTaskIncrementTick() and vTaskSwitchContext()
Due to SMP, critical sections have been added to xTaskIncrementTick() and
vTaskSwitchContext() (to take the xKernelLock). However, this is technically
not necessary when building for single-core as FreeRTOS expect these funcitons
to be called with interrupts already disabled.

This commit makes the critical secitons in those functions depend on
"configNUM_CORES > 1", and ensures that interrupts are disabled when calling
those functions. This effectively restores the vanilla behavior for these
functions when building for single-core.

816ddc8867 freertos(SMP): Fix SMP FreeRTOS portDISABLE_INTERRUPTS() macro on xtensa port
The portDISABLE_INTERRUPTS() macro on Xtensa should return only the interrupt
mask/level before the interrupts were disabled. Previously, the entire contents
of PS register were returned (i.e., direct return from RSIL instruction without
any bit masking or shifting).

This commit fixes the portDISABLE_INTERRUPTS() macro to return the INTLEVEL
bitfield of the PS register.

ae3383ddc5 freertos: Remove/restore queue locks for multi-core/single-core
This commit removes the updates the usage of queue locks in IDF FreeRTOS

Queue locks are present in Vanilla FreeRTOS to ensure that queue functions
behave deterministicly in critical sections (i.e., no walking linked lists
while interrupts are disabled). However, currently in IDF FreeRTOS...

- When configNUM_CORES > 1, IDF FreeRTOS drops the determinism requirement.
Thus, queue functions could be simplified if queue locks were not used at all
(and have a queue function do everything inside the same critical section).

- When configNUM_CORES == 1, the current queue implementation in IDF FreeRTOS
does not meet the determinism requirements, as critical sections are used
(instead of scheduler suspension) when locking/unlocking the queues.

There, this commit updates multiple queue functions so that

- When configNUM_CORES > 1
    - Queue locks are no longer used. All actions are done within the same
      critical section.
    - Affected queue functions now need 40% less CPU clock cycles when blocking
- When configNUM_CORES = 1
    - Queue locks are still used.
    - Vanilla behavior of suspending the scheduler is restored when locking
      the queue. Thus queue fucntions are now deterministic and have the same
      behavior as Vanilla FreeRTOS.
    - Affected queue functions now takes 36% more CPU clock cycles when
      blocking (due to the scheduler suspension/resumption).
